A tragic wrongful death lawsuit in Philadelphia sheds light on the dangers of medical malpractice, particularly medication errors caused by inaccurate patient information. In a recently filed case, a 120-pound woman was mistakenly recorded as 275 pounds, resulting in a fatal overdose of the anticoagulant medication Lovenox.
